Kelly E. MacQueen, Esq.
ATTORNEY
Kelly E. MacQueen is an attorney with MacQueen & Gottlieb. Kelly practices primarily in the areas of real estate and equine law and is admitted to practice in both Arizona and South Carolina.
Kelly graduated 3rd in her class from John Marshall Savannah Law School after receiving a full tuition waiver based on her work experiences, undergraduate academic standing and her LSAT scores.
Prior to attending law school, Kelly spent 8 years working in the criminal justice system in Savannah, Georgia; most of those years were spent as a Juvenile Probation Officer.
When Kelly is not practicing law you can find her managing Equine Sports Medicine & Chiropractic Care, LLC, an equine veterinary practice and rehabilitation facility located in coastal South Carolina or, in the show ring with her Half-Arabians, out fox hunting with her Hanoverian or running a half marathon with her husband.
